After a string of five wins, the Rocky Mountain Lobos's good fortune finally ran out on Saturday. They took a 67-54 hit to the loss column at the hands of Mullen. Rocky Mountain was given a dose of their own medicine in this game as Mullen ap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played back in January of 2023.
Sara Chicco and Kenna Wagner certainly did their best on Saturday to try and avoid the loss. Chicco scored 21 points, while Wagner scored 18 points along with five assists and five rebounds. Wagner hasn't dropped below two steals for 11 straight games. The team also got some help courtesy of Meela Delap, who scored six points.
Leading Mullen to victory were Makenzie Jones and Allison Schwertner. Jones scored 19 points along with six rebounds, while Schwertner scored 19 points along with eight rebounds and three steals. Another player making a difference was Ryker Thomas, who scored eight points.
Rocky Mountain's defeat dropped their record down to 9-3. As for Mullen, they are on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six matches, which provided a nice bump to their 9-4 record this season.
